Barnes & Noble The Marty Feldman of his era, and then some, Rowan Atkinson ranks among the premier physical comedians of our time. His Mr. Bean programs, created in his post-Blackadder period, dazzled audiences worldwide, bringing Atkinson international acclaim and spawning a hit feature film. The pathetic but endearing Mr. Bean is a simple man who manages to get enmeshed and usually imperiled in various bits of tomfoolery, though he always digs himself out of his fixes in delightfully ingenious ways. This three-disc set compiles all 14 Bean episodes plus the documentary "The Story of Bean" and the never-before-seen sketches "Bus Stop" and "Library."
